淳(chun)
Name meaning
淳 (chun) means mellow honesty, unspoiled simplicity and warm plainness. In naming it reads as grounded goodness and humane steadiness, not rusticity.

Historical / name-use references
淳于髡 (Chunyu Kun)
淳于髡 (chun yu kun) Chunyu Kun was a Warring States figure known for wit and persuasion. His name directly contains 淳 (chun), giving the character a historical and rhetorical anchor.
